On , OSHA opened an unprogrammed Other safety inspection of RED LINE CONSTRUCTION, INC. in 4340 VANCE ST., WHEAT RIDGE, CO 80033 (NAICS 236116). OSHA activity number 332826627.
O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.501(b)(13): Where the employer was engaged in residential construction activities 6 feet (1.8m) or more above lower levels employees were not protected from falling by guardrail systems, safety net systems, or personal fall arrest system: a) On or about March 22, 2012, and at times prior, employees were exposed to falls in excess of 6 feet while rolling floor joists.

General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.1051(a): Stairway(s) or ladder(s) were not provided at all personnel points of access where there was a break in elevation of 19 inches (48 cm) or more, or no ramp, runway, sloped embankment, or personnel hoist was provided: a) On or about March 22, 2012, and at times prior, employees were exposed to falls in excess of 10 feet. Employees were using the braces to access the first floor in order to roll floor joists.
